Masks
Masks deliver concentrated treatment in a single session — clay masks draw out impurities, hydrating masks plump and soothe, and sheet masks provide a quick moisture boost.
The DermFND database contains 107 products within the Masks category, with niacinamide, hyaluronic acid, centella asiatica, panthenol, glycerin, ceramides, kaolin, squalane, probiotics prebiotics, and adenosine identified as the most common active ingredients. Product pricing in this category ranges from $1 to $350, with an average price of $42. The data indicates a category average DermFND score of 74.2/100.
